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
616 0332 1960666 99611798539 00469589356
49 4833072 582216666
49 4833072 582216666
5431 9049734081 6309
All about undefined
Interested in learning more?
49 4833072 582216666
5431 9049734081 6309
See more
84251413 907 9084232
93700982 5542708 081485
See more
4794310 552
62 1956 712 720228 1976693
See more